Best state for taxes, for this income and this house

Best-for-taxes lists disagree because they weight income, property, and sales differently. Your household is one of those weightings. Write it down.

How to use a list without obeying it

Take two or three states from a list you trust enough to start with. Recalculate with your income and the housing you would occupy. Keep stay as an option.

If the ranking flips when housing is included, the original list was answering a different question.
